2020-09-13 21:21发布
加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)
嗨,人们
使用标准BAPI更新文章时,出现错误"销售期必须在可用性期内"。
在表MAW1和MVKE中,有效日期看起来还可以。
对此有什么解决方案? 谢谢。
转到MM42,在"列表"选项卡下,将日期更改为商店和DC的当前系统日期。
保存您的更改。
之后尝试使用BAPI更改UPC,它不应引发任何错误。
Mayank
太好了,谢谢您的答复/建议。 是的,这些日期必须更新,标准代码是将FMKE中的MARA-DATAB与MVKE-VDVFL/MVKE-VDVZL/MAW1-VDVFL/MAW1-VDVZL进行比较:MVKE_SPECIAL_CHECK_GEN_RETAIL
已经尝试过手动维护材料时是否收到相同的消息?
如果您没有在在线交易中收到消息,则可以确定您在BAPI中移动了错误的日期,如果您也收到错误消息,则说明它与BAPI和ABAP不相关。 但是,作为ABAPer,您应该能够轻松地找到触发MH032消息的代码,以查看SAP比较哪些字段。
您是对的,谢谢
感谢您的回应,我理解了,但我要做的就是使用标准BAPI更新EAN/UPC。 这是针对现有样式及其变体的,调用BAPI时不会填充任何日期
我已经调试了2天以上,并且此错误消息是在嵌套循环内动态填充的,而不是简单的错误消息。 物品之间存在某些联系,并且此销售期必须在可用性期内,并且尚不清楚,因为并非每种通用商品/样式都在这种情况下发生。
最多设置5个标签!
转到MM42,在"列表"选项卡下,将日期更改为商店和DC的当前系统日期。
保存您的更改。
之后尝试使用BAPI更改UPC,它不应引发任何错误。
Mayank
太好了,谢谢您的答复/建议。 是的,这些日期必须更新,标准代码是将FMKE中的MARA-DATAB与MVKE-VDVFL/MVKE-VDVZL/MAW1-VDVFL/MAW1-VDVZL进行比较:MVKE_SPECIAL_CHECK_GEN_RETAIL
已经尝试过手动维护材料时是否收到相同的消息?
如果您没有在在线交易中收到消息,则可以确定您在BAPI中移动了错误的日期,如果您也收到错误消息,则说明它与BAPI和ABAP不相关。 但是,作为ABAPer,您应该能够轻松地找到触发MH032消息的代码,以查看SAP比较哪些字段。
您是对的,谢谢
感谢您的回应,我理解了,但我要做的就是使用标准BAPI更新EAN/UPC。 这是针对现有样式及其变体的,调用BAPI时不会填充任何日期
我已经调试了2天以上,并且此错误消息是在嵌套循环内动态填充的,而不是简单的错误消息。 物品之间存在某些联系,并且此销售期必须在可用性期内,并且尚不清楚,因为并非每种通用商品/样式都在这种情况下发生。
一周热门 更多>